Daily Habits That Preserve Your Floors' Beauty

 

A significant part of wood flooring treatment is uniformity. Day-to-day tasks such as strolling with damp footwear or dragging furniture can accelerate deterioration. It's amazing how much of a distinction tiny changes can make. Something as straightforward as leaving footwear at the door or sweeping with a soft mop every evening can extend the life of your floor's coating.

 

It's also important to manage dampness meticulously. Timber and water have a challenging connection. A moist mop could feel like the ideal tool, but way too much water can leak into joints and trigger swelling or deforming over time. A a little moist microfiber mop is a better option-- and if you're in an area like San Jose, where seaside air can be humid, maintaining humidity degrees constant indoors is equally as vital.

 

Seasonal Changes and How to Handle Them

 

Seasonal changes commonly imply adjustments in humidity and temperature level, which hardwood floors reply to more than the majority of recognize. You might discover your floor covering expanding a little in the summer and contracting in the winter. These changes are regular, but if they're as well severe, gaps or distorting can take place.

Taking care of Scratches and Dullness properly

 

Over time, minor scratches and scuffs are inescapable. The secret is to resolve them prior to they grow or gather. If you have pet dogs or frequently rearrange furniture, you'll see even more indicators of surface area wear. Really felt pads under furniture legs can stop most of these concerns, yet what regarding the marks that already exist?

 

Light scratches can typically be buffed out with a touch-up pen or wood repair package. For monotony, utilizing a floor polish that's suitable with your coating can bring back a few of the original luster. Long-Term Maintenance: When and How to Refinish

 

Every floor gets to a point where basic cleansing no longer revitalizes its appearance. That's where refinishing comes in. This procedure involves fining sand down the surface to get rid of old surfaces and then using a new safety coat. Depending upon the wear and type of wood, floorings can normally be refinished every 7 to 10 years.
